[Press Processing Example] Angled Hole Drilling Flange

Diagonal hole processing on a flat plate! Hole processing at a 60° angle can also be handled by pressing!

■This is a product with angled holes for flange installation on pipes. ■A Φ19 hole is drilled at a 60° angle to the top surface. ■Traditionally, due to issues with mold life and quality, angled hole drilling on flat surfaces could only be addressed through machining such as drilling, but our company has achieved this processing solely through pressing. ■Since it is processed by pressing, the processing speed is fast, and there are advantages in maintaining stable quality for hole diameter, hole pitch, and burr height. ■Additionally, unlike drilling, the generation of chips is minimized, so there is no need for burr removal or cleaning after processing. ■This product meets the request for angled holes, but the scrap portion where the angled hole is removed also has a shape with a slope on the outer contour, allowing for applications to meet requests for products with a sloped outer contour.

[Press Processing Example] Complete Pressing / SUS Thick Plate / Multiple Hole Processing

Challenging processing that far exceeds the limits of pressing! By replacing the machining method that created 34 holes with pressing processing, we achieved significant cost reduction!

This is a product made of stainless steel with a diameter of 80mm and a thickness of 3mm, featuring 34 holes with a diameter of 10.2mm. In conventional press processing, it is said that a pitch of twice the plate thickness is required between holes, meaning that for a plate thickness of 3mm, a hole pitch of 6mm is necessary for the press processing to be feasible. However, the hole pitch of this product is a minimum of 0.95mm, which is less than one-sixth of the value considered the limit for press processing, so the customer had no choice but to handle all the holes through machining. Naturally, this resulted in increased production time and costs, causing significant difficulties for the customer. Upon consulting with us, we began developing a press processing method. After various twists and turns, we succeeded in converting the entire process to press processing (excluding the finishing burr removal barrel), achieving significant cost reductions, which greatly pleased the customer.

[Development Case] Achieving processing at "1/16" of the limits of press processing.

Contributes to a 35% cost reduction compared to conventional methods! Developed a unique method! Can be manufactured using only press and rotary grinding!

We would like to introduce a case where processing was achieved at "1/16th" of the limits of press processing. This product is made of thick plate and is designed with large cutouts on the outer circumference due to space constraints, with a thickness of 1mm at the cutout section for an 8mm thick plate. Previously, machining was necessary, but we developed a unique method that allows for production using only pressing and rotary grinding, contributing to a 35% cost reduction compared to conventional methods. [Results] - By enabling processing with only pressing and rotary grinding, we contributed to a 35% cost reduction compared to conventional methods. - The inner diameter meets almost all shear surface requirements (customer requirement is over 70% shear surface). - Taper processing for hole entry, which is difficult without machining, is also handled by pressing. - Three linear beads (linear protrusions) with an inner diameter of R0.25 are also processed by pressing. *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

[Press Processing Example] For Lithium-Ion Batteries / HEAT SINK

A fully automated production line from material input to press processing and packaging! Minimizing contamination without human touch!

A fully automated process from material input to press processing, drying, and packaging. Since there is no human touch, contamination is minimized. The pressing is done with dry oil, and the drying process eliminates any residual oil, ensuring no issues with wettability. - Monthly production of 250,000 units is possible for mass production. - Used in EV vehicles of domestic automobile manufacturers (40 pieces per vehicle).

[Technical Handbook Presentation] How to Reduce Costs in Mass Production Part 2

From cutting processing to press processing! Achieving cost reduction by replacing the method!

We would like to introduce points for reducing costs in mass production manufacturing. While machining through cutting allows for high-precision finishing, it requires a corresponding amount of processing time. Press processing, although slightly inferior in terms of precision compared to cutting, is overwhelmingly superior in production efficiency. If parts that were previously manufactured through cutting can be produced using press processing, significant cost reductions can be expected. 【Advantages of Press Processing】 ■ By creating a progressive die, products can be processed semi-automatically. ■ If the shape is suitable for press processing, it is well-suited for mass production. ■ Choosing press processing for long-term mass production increases productivity. ■ By setting up a die on the press machine, it is possible to repeatedly produce the same product. ■ Depending on the product shape and flow period, there may be advantages even for small lot products. *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

Advantages of reverse squeezing press processing

Reverse drawing press processing that allows for the creation of very complex shapes even in multi-stage drawing processes.

We would like to introduce a complex forming technology that simultaneously performs "deep drawing" and "reverse drawing." Reverse drawing press processing makes it possible to produce a product that would normally require the assembly of two parts as a single unit. This processing method is very advantageous in terms of material and processing costs, and it can create very complex shapes even in multi-stage drawing processes. 【Technical Overview】 ■ An advanced processing method that forms a significantly deep drawing shape in the punching direction of the press and further draws in the reverse direction to create a beading shape. ■ Capable of creating very complex shapes even in multi-stage drawing processes. ■ Very advantageous in terms of material and processing costs. ■ Material: SPHD t2.0mm *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

Toyo Metal Industry Co., Ltd. "Ultra Deep Drawing Processing"

Deep drawing, considered the most difficult among various pressing processes.

"Deep drawing processing" requires many appropriate processing conditions, including mold material, mold precision, mold shape, processing sequence layout design, type of processing oil, amount of processing oil applied, processing speed, processing temperature, workpiece material, and mold setting precision. Toyo Metal Industry Co., Ltd. is a specialized group in deep drawing processing. Many skilled engineers with excellent know-how backed by years of rich experience ensure quality. Mold press processing [Press bending (bending processing)]

Not only can it be bent at right angles, but it can also be processed at various angles! It can be processed with materials such as iron and copper.

"Bending processing" refers to the process of bending flat metal sheets using molds. Processing thin metals often requires strict precision, making it very difficult to achieve dimensions according to specifications. Our company specializes in the production of small press products (length 10mm, width 3mm, material brass sheet C2680, thickness 0.5mm, tolerance ±0.1) and bending products approximately the size of a palm (bending products made from SPHC with a thickness of 4.5mm), as well as the manufacturing of press molds. We can process not only right angles but also various angles. Additionally, we can work with materials such as iron and copper. 【Features】 - We excel in the press processing of small press products and bending products approximately the size of a palm, as well as the production of press molds. - We accommodate two types of processing: "progressive molds" and "single-action molds." - We offer a wide variety of materials tailored to your requests. - We can provide consistent plating treatment from pressing. *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.
